Our client Net Promoter Score of 68 twice the industry average. The Position We're looking to hire a Senior AWS DevOps Engineer to join our team. You'll work with one of our incredible product teams to build and deliver a product to our clients. What We're Looking For 5+ years of professional DevOps Engineering experience. Advanced English is required. Successful completion of a four-year college degree is required. Extensive experience working with AWS cloud services (EC2 S3 Lambda RDS EKS etc.). Deep experience in Kubernetes for container orchestration in production environments. Proven experience with Infrastructure-as-Code using Terraform. Hands-on experience building and maintaining CI/CD pipelines for cloud-native applications. Deep experience in monitoring logging and observability tools (e.g. CloudWatch Prometheus Grafana). Solid understanding of security best practices and compliance in cloud environments. Familiar with scripting languages such as Python Bash or similar for automation. Experience leveraging Agentic AI tools to automate DevOps workflows and improve operational efficiency is a plus. Ability to work through new and difficult issues and contribute to libraries as needed. Ability to create and maintain continuous integration and delivery of applications. Forensic attention to detail. A positive mindset and a can-do attitude. Experience working on Agile / Scrum teams. Meaningful experience working on large complex systems.
